Tee-Ball Division (League Age 4-6)

Tee Ball is the perfect program for young players just starting to learn the game. Using an adjustable batting tee, it focuses on fun and fundamental skill development. The structured curriculum, developed by Little League International, includes one practice and one game per week, offering a balanced approach to learning. Coaches and parents work together through up to 40 activities designed to teach essential skills while keeping kids active and engaged. This program provides a positive, hands-on introduction to the sport, helping children build confidence and love for the game.

Coach Pitch Division (League Age 7-8)

This level uses traditional coach pitch rules to introduce a higher level of competition and skill development. Scores are kept to promote a sense of competition, and the games last up to two hours, with a maximum of six innings, allowing for focused play and skill-building. Designed for league-age 7 players, developing league-age 8 players, and new league-age 8 players, this level provides the structure and challenges needed to prepare athletes for more competitive baseball while emphasizing player development.

Minor Division (League Age 8-10)

Play at this level consists of 8 to 10-year-old players who demonstrate a solid foundation of essential skills and show potential for advanced development in hitting, pitching, and fielding. This division is designed to support players ready for increased challenges while still progressing toward the mastery required in the Majors. The focus is on refining advanced hitting techniques, developing consistent pitching mechanics, strengthening defensive strategies, and expanding knowledge of situational awareness and game strategies with an emphasis on decision-making under game conditions.

The division plays on a field with a 46-foot pitching distance and 60-foot base paths, following Little League rules, including pitch counts and playing time requirements. The season consists of 1-2 practices per week and 1-2 games per week, weather permitting, and concludes with a division tournament. This is a "competitive" division, and players are eligible for the Little League International tournament starting in early July within Maryland District 7.

This division is a draft, where players are placed on teams via a draft based on mandatory skill evaluations to ensure competitive balance. Coach and teammate requests are not prioritized.

Major Division (League Age 10-12)

Play at this level consists of 10 to 12-year-old players who have mastered the essential skills and are able to perform many advanced skills in hitting, fielding, and pitching. The focus is on the continued development of hitting, pitching, base running, and defensive techniques, while expanding on situational awareness and game strategies.

This division plays on a field with a 46-foot pitching distance and 60-foot base paths, following Little League rules, including pitch counts and playing time requirements. Major League teams consist of up to 2 practices per week (at coaches' discretion) and 2 games per week, weather permitting. The season culminates with a division tournament to end the season. Majors is a "competitive" division, and players are eligible for the Little League International tournament starting in early July within Maryland District 7.

Majors is a draft division, where players are placed on teams via a draft based on mandatory skill evaluations to ensure competitive balance. Coach and teammate requests are not prioritized.

Intermediate Division (League Age 13)

Play at this level consists of 11 to 13-year-old players who have mastered the essential skills and can perform many advanced skills in hitting, fielding, and pitching. The focus is on continuing the development of skills covered in the Majors division while introducing concepts like leading, regular stealing, pick-off moves, and additional defensive techniques.

This division plays on a field with a 50-foot pitching distance and 70-foot base paths. Little League created this division to help transition players from the smaller 60-foot field to the 90-foot field used in the Juniors division and for high-school level play. Little League rules are followed, including pitch counts and playing time requirements. Intermediate teams play between 12 and 16 games and may travel to other District 7 leagues for inter-league play. The season culminates with a division tournament. Players from this division are eligible for the Little League International tournament in July within Maryland District 7.

Games are scheduled for Wednesdays and Sundays to avoid conflicts with Majors and Juniors division games, allowing players to participate in both the Intermediate and Majors or Juniors divisions without overlapping game times.


Junior Division (League Age 13-14)

Play at this level consists of 13 to 14-year-old players who have mastered the essential skills and can perform many advanced skills in hitting, fielding, and pitching. The focus is on continuing the development of skills covered in the Intermediate division while introducing players to additional techniques utilized on the larger 90-foot field.

This division plays on a field with a 60’-6” pitching distance and 90-foot base paths. Little League rules are followed, including pitch counts and playing time requirements. Junior teams play between 12 and 16 games and may travel to other District 7 leagues for inter-league play. The season culminates with a division tournament. Players from this division are eligible for the Little League International tournament in July within Maryland District 7.

Juniors is a draft division, where players are placed on teams via a draft based on mandatory skill evaluations to ensure competitive balance. Coach and teammate requests are not prioritized.

Senior Division (League Age 15-16)

Play at this level consists of 15 to 16-year-old players who have mastered the essential skills and can perform many advanced skills in hitting, fielding, and pitching. The focus is on continuing the development of skills covered in the Junior division while introducing players to additional techniques utilized on the larger 90-foot field.

This division plays on a field with a 60’-6” pitching distance and 90-foot base paths. Little League rules are followed, including pitch counts and playing time requirements. Junior teams play between 12 and 16 games and may travel to other District 7 leagues for inter-league play. The season culminates with a division tournament. Players from this division are eligible for the Little League International tournament in July within Maryland District 7.

Senior is a draft division, where players are placed on teams via a draft based on mandatory skill evaluations to ensure competitive balance. Coach and teammate requests are not prioritized.
